C++
abing0513
这个作者很懒,什么都没留下…
展开
-
C++中整数最值的表示方法
整体来说C++/C中的最大值是跟编译器有关的,事关具体类型的存储形式。对于int型数据,一般机器都是以4Bytes来存储,也就是说对于无符号类型的最大值为2^32-1=4294967295,对应的二进制码为:0xffffffff(四字节全1);对于有符号来说其最大值最小值范围为:-2^31~2^21-1,其中-2^31=-2147483648,二进制码字为0x80000000(符号位1,其余全原创 2013-11-15 22:07:45 · 10907 阅读 · 0 评论 -
【转载】ubuntu下编译安装boost库
原文地址:http://www.cnblogs.com/longcpp/archive/2012/06/06/2538251.html说明:本文为转载,只为自己学习使用。环境:ubuntu 12.04 32bit,boost 1.49前期准备:boost中,用到了别的函数库,所以为了使用boost中相应的功能,需要先安装系统中可能缺失的库 ?apt-get ins原创 2013-10-08 15:32:35 · 903 阅读 · 0 评论 -
boost库安装过程中的问题解决
boost_1_54_0的安装先解压缩,直接提取文件然后进入该目录:cd /.../boost_1_54_0执行 ./bootstrap.sh然后执行sudo ./b2 install最后会出现…… The Boost C++ Libraries were successfullybuilt! The following directory should be added原创 2013-10-08 15:32:31 · 2288 阅读 · 0 评论 -
C++类的学习笔记
1、关于类的初始化 如果类中设置了成员变量,那么你就必须对每一个成员变量都配备类内初始化,或者在构造函数中进行初始化。如果你没有这样做,那么编译器会为这些成员变量指定默认值,但这个默认值可能并不和你心意,因为它可能会使结构体的某些域未被初始化,或者初始化成一个你不满意的值; 当new一个新的类对象时,如果不传入任何参数,则会调用默认的构造函数;原创 2014-03-07 09:35:24 · 649 阅读 · 0 评论 -
C语言的整型溢出问题
说明:本文转载自转载 2014-04-22 19:57:44 · 880 阅读 · 0 评论 -
我的C++程序遇到的错误---纯属个人笔记
这篇文章记载学习工作中C++程序遇到的错误、错误原因、解决方案等。属于没遇见一个新的错误更新本文一次。纯属个人笔记1、expected initializer before ‘namespace’在头文件中声明函数,在cc文件中定义及使用,一不小心出现如下错误: In file included from /home/abing/software/lte_ul_r原创 2013-11-28 11:33:50 · 4441 阅读 · 2 评论